Hướng dẫn tối ưu hóa WordPress cuối cùng: Giải pháp toàn diện từ tốc độ, bảo mật đến SEO

Đọc trong 2 phút
2026-04-10
2026-06-03
2,398
Tôi kiếm được hoa hồng khi bạn mua sắm thông qua các liên kết dưới đây, mà không phát sinh thêm chi phí nào cho bạn.

Tối ưu hóa chiến lược cốt lõi: Bộ nhớ đệm và cơ sở dữ liệu

Nhiệm vụ hàng đầu để tăng tốc WordPress là triển khai chiến lược bộ nhớ đệm hiệu quả. Bộ nhớ đệm có thể giảm số lần máy chủ xử lý yêu cầu, từ đó giảm đáng kể thời gian tải trang. Có nhiều phương pháp bộ nhớ đệm ở các cấp độ khác nhau trong WordPress.

Sử dụng bộ nhớ đệm đối tượng để cải thiện hiệu suất dữ liệu động

Đối với nội dung động, bộ nhớ đệm đối tượng là rất quan trọng. Công nghệ cốt lõi của nó làWP_Object_CacheKhi trang web sử dụng bộ nhớ đệm đối tượng bền vững bên ngoài (như Redis hoặc Memcached), áp lực truy vấn cơ sở dữ liệu sẽ giảm đáng kể. Bạn có thể kích hoạt nó bằng cách thêm mã tương ứng vào tệpwp-config.php. Ví dụ, đối với Redis, có thể sử dụng máy khách Predis hoặc PhpRedis. Một ví dụ cấu hình đơn giản có thể như sau:

// 在 wp-config.php 中启用 Redis 对象缓存
define('WP_REDIS_HOST', '127.0.0.1');
define('WP_REDIS_PORT', 6379);
define('WP_REDIS_TIMEOUT', 1);
define('WP_REDIS_READ_TIMEOUT', 1);

Xóa dữ liệu dư thừa và tối ưu hóa bảng dữ liệu

Cơ sở dữ liệu là nền tảng cho tốc độ và sức khỏe của trang web. Sau thời gian dài hoạt động, cơ sở dữ liệu sẽ tích lũy nhiều dữ liệu dư thừa, như các phiên bản sửa đổi, bản nháp, bình luận rác và các tùy chọn tạm thời đã hết hạn. Việc dọn dẹp định kỳ những dữ liệu này là cần thiết. Có thể sử dụng các công cụ nhưwp_optimizewp-sweepSử dụng plugin để dọn dẹp an toàn. Ngoài ra, tối ưu hóa bảng cơ sở dữ liệu cũng là một thói quen tốt. Bạn có thể thực hiện thông qua phpMyAdminOPTIMIZE TABLEcâu lệnh, hoặc sử dụng plugin để tự động hoàn thành. Khi tối ưu hóa thủ công, hãy chắc chắn thực hiện sao lưu đầy đủ trước.

Đọc thêm Hướng dẫn tối ưu hiệu suất WordPress cuối cùng: Tăng tốc độ tải và trải nghiệm người dùng

Mẹo tăng tốc hiệu suất trang web

Thời gian phản hồi của máy chủ và hiệu suất tải tài nguyên ảnh hưởng trực tiếp đến trải nghiệm người dùng và thứ hạng trên công cụ tìm kiếm. Cần phải tối ưu cả giao diện và cấu hình phía máy chủ cùng lúc.

UltaHost – Nhà cung cấp dịch vụ máy chủ WordPress chuyên nghiệp
Bảo đảm hoàn tiền trong 30 ngày, băng thông và cơ sở dữ liệu không giới hạn, bảo vệ DDoS miễn phí, mua 3 năm ưu đãi 50%

Tối ưu hóa hình ảnh và tài nguyên tĩnh

Hình ảnh chưa được tối ưu là nguyên nhân chính làm chậm tốc độ trang web. Bạn nên: 1) Sử dụng plugin như ShortPixel, Imagify hoặc công cụ dòng lệnh để tự động nén hình ảnh khi tải lên; 2) Kích hoạt lazy loading, để hình ảnh ngoài màn hình đầu chỉ tải khi người dùng cuộn đến vị trí của chúng, điều này có thể thực hiện thông qua thuộc tínhloading="lazy"thực hiện; 3) Sử dụng định dạng hình ảnh hiện đại như WebP; 4) Kết hợp và thu nhỏ các tệp CSS và JavaScript. Nhiều plugin bộ nhớ đệm (như WP Rocket, W3 Total Cache) đều cung cấp tính năng này, cũng có thể sử dụngAutoptimizePlugin xử lý chuyên biệt.

Sử dụng hiệu quả mạng lưới phân phối nội dung

CDN có thể phân phối tài nguyên tĩnh (hình ảnh, CSS, JS, phông chữ) của bạn tới các máy chủ nút trên toàn cầu. Khi người dùng truy cập, CDN sẽ cung cấp các tệp này từ nút gần nhất với họ, cải thiện đáng kể tốc độ tải. Cloudflare là một lựa chọn phổ biến cho người mới bắt đầu, đồng thời cung cấp bảo vệ an ninh. Để tích hợp CDN, thường cần cấu hình URL CDN trong plugin, hoặc sử dụngwp-config.phptrongWP_CONTENT_URLhằng số để định nghĩa.

Cải thiện cài đặt bảo mật

Một trang web an toàn là nền tảng cho trải nghiệm người dùng tốt và SEO. Do tính phổ biến của mình, WordPress thường trở thành mục tiêu tấn công phổ biến, vì vậy việc chủ động bảo vệ là rất quan trọng.

Tăng cường đăng nhập và kiểm soát truy cập

Giới hạn số lần đăng nhập là tuyến phòng thủ đầu tiên chống lại các cuộc tấn công brute force. Bạn có thể sử dụng plugin nhưWordfence SecurityiThemes Securityđể giới hạn số lần thử, kích hoạt xác thực hai yếu tố (2FA), và đổi tên mặc định của/wp-adminURL đăng nhập. Ngoài ra, thông qua.htaccesstệp (máy chủ Apache) hoặc tệp cấu hình trang web (Nginx) để hạn chế quyền truy cập vào các tệp nhạy cảm (chẳng hạn nhưwp-config.phpxmlrpc.php), có thể đóng các điểm vào không cần thiết.

Đọc thêm Hướng dẫn tối ưu tốc độ trang web WordPress tối thượng: Từ cơ bản đến nâng cao

Cập nhật thường xuyên và giám sát tính toàn vẹn tệp

Luôn duy trì việc cập nhật WordPress core, theme và plugin lên phiên bản mới nhất là phương pháp hiệu quả nhất để vá các lỗ hổng bảo mật. Ngoài cập nhật, cần giám sát tính toàn vẹn của các tệp core. Các plugin bảo mật có thể cung cấp tính năng phát hiện thay đổi tệp, cảnh báo khi các tệp core bị sửa đổi ngoài ý muốn. Đồng thời, đảm bảo tệpwp-config.phpcủa bạn được đặt quyền là440400và đảm bảo nó chứa thông tin đăng nhập cơ sở dữ liệu và các khóa an toàn. Sử dụnghttps://api.wordpress.org/secret-key/1.1/salt/để tạo và cập nhật các khóa xác thực.

Thực hành cốt lõi về Tối ưu hóa Công cụ Tìm kiếm

SEO kỹ thuật tạo nền tảng để nội dung được công cụ tìm kiếm phát hiện và lập chỉ mục, trong khi trải nghiệm người dùng tốt có thể cải thiện thứ hạng.

Cấu trúc trang web và cấu hình liên kết cố định

Cấu trúc URL rõ ràng, chứa từ khóa thân thiện hơn với cả người dùng và công cụ tìm kiếm. Trong “Cài đặt” -> “Liên kết cố định”, chọn “Tên bài viết” hoặc cấu trúc tùy chỉnh, chẳng hạn như/%category%/%postname%/。Đảm bảo trang web có menu điều hướng logic rõ ràng và breadcrumb navigation. Tạo một sơ đồ trang XML toàn diện, tự động tạo và cập nhật thông qua plugin nhưGoogle XML Sitemapsvà gửi nó đến Google Search Console và Bing Webmaster Tools.

Hosting.com - lưu trữ chia sẻ
Hiệu năng cao, được trang bị CPU AMD EPYC, lưu trữ SSD NVMe và LiteSpeed, hỗ trợ chuyên gia nội bộ 24 giờ/ngày, các biện pháp bảo mật tiên tiến bao gồm SSL, chống brute force, phần mềm độc hại và bảo vệ DDoS, tiết kiệm tới 73%.

Ứng dụng thẻ meta và dữ liệu có cấu trúc

Mỗi trang nên có thẻ tiêu đề (Title Tag) và mô tả meta (Meta Description) duy nhất, mô tả. Các plugin SEO nhưYoast SEORank MathCó thể đơn giản hóa đáng kể quá trình này. Tiến thêm một bước, thêm dữ liệu có cấu trúc (Schema Markup) cho nội dung chính (như bài viết, sản phẩm, sự kiện). Điều này giúp công cụ tìm kiếm hiểu nội dung trang và có thể hiển thị dưới dạng đoạn mã phong phú (Rich Snippets) trong kết quả tìm kiếm. Bạn có thể sử dụng các plugin này hoặc thủ công thêm mã JSON-LD vàoheader.phpmẫu hoặc thông qua hàm hookwp_headchèn vào.

Tóm lại

Tối ưu hóa toàn diện WordPress là một công việc hệ thống bao trùm tốc độ, bảo mật và SEO, cả ba bổ trợ lẫn nhau. Tối ưu hóa tốc độ cung cấp trải nghiệm tức thì cho người dùng thông qua bộ nhớ đệm, dọn dẹp cơ sở dữ liệu và CDN; củng cố bảo mật bảo vệ dữ liệu và danh tiếng của bạn thông qua cập nhật, kiểm soát truy cập và giám sát; thực hành SEO thì thông qua cấu trúc rõ ràng, siêu dữ liệu và dữ liệu có cấu trúc, xây dựng cầu nối giữa trang web với công cụ tìm kiếm và người dùng mục tiêu. Chìa khóa thành công nằm ở việc bảo trì liên tục, chứ không phải cài đặt một lần. Bằng cách tích hợp các chiến lược này vào quy trình quản lý hàng ngày của bạn, trang WordPress của bạn sẽ không chỉ chạy nhanh hơn, an toàn hơn mà còn nổi bật trong cuộc cạnh tranh trên kết quả tìm kiếm.

FAQ 常见问题

Làm thế nào để đo lường cải thiện tốc độ website sau khi tối ưu hóa?

Bạn có thể sử dụng nhiều công cụ miễn phí để định lượng hiệu quả tối ưu hóa. PageSpeed Insights và Lighthouse của Google cung cấp điểm số hiệu suất toàn diện và đề xuất cải tiến. GTmetrix và WebPageTest có thể cung cấp dòng thời gian tải chi tiết, biểu đồ thác nước và kết quả kiểm tra từ các vị trí địa lý khác nhau. Thực hiện kiểm tra trước và sau khi tối ưu hóa và so sánh các chỉ số chính, như LCP (Largest Contentful Paint), FID (First Input Delay) và CLS (Cumulative Layout Shift).

Đọc thêm Hướng dẫn Tối ưu hóa WordPress Toàn diện: 30 Mẹo Thực tế Để Cải thiện Hiệu suất Website & Thứ hạng SEO

Việc sử dụng nhiều plugin bộ nhớ đệm có xung đột không?

Có, việc đồng thời kích hoạt nhiều plugin bộ nhớ đệm đầy đủ tính năng (ví dụ: W3 Total Cache và WP Super Cache) hầu như chắc chắn sẽ gây ra xung đột, dẫn đến hiển thị website bất thường, chức năng bị lỗi hoặc thậm chí màn hình trắng. Chúng sẽ cố gắng xử lý cùng một quy trình bộ nhớ đệm theo các cách khác nhau, gây ra xung đột quy tắc. Cách làm tốt nhất là chỉ chọn một plugin bộ nhớ đệm đầy đủ tính năng và cấu hình đúng. Nếu bạn đang sử dụng bộ nhớ đệm ở cấp độ máy chủ (như Varnish), hãy lưu ý điều chỉnh cài đặt plugin WordPress để tránh bộ nhớ đệm trùng lặp.

Ngoài plugin, làm thế nào để tự tay dọn dẹp cơ sở dữ liệu một cách hiệu quả?

Có thể dọn dẹp thủ công bằng cách chạy trực tiếp truy vấn SQL, nhưng phải sao lưu cơ sở dữ liệu trước khi thao tác. Các thao tác dọn dẹp phổ biến bao gồm: xóa bản nháp tự động (DELETE FROM wp_posts WHERE post_status = 'auto-draft';), làm trống thùng rác (DELETE FROM wp_posts WHERE post_status = 'trash';), và xóa các tùy chọn tạm thời đã hết hạn (DELETE FROM wp_options WHERE option_name LIKE '%_transient_%' AND option_value < UNIX_TIMESTAMP();). Đối với người dùng thông thường, sử dụng plugin dọn dẹp đáng tin cậy là lựa chọn an toàn hơn.

Máy chủ chia sẻ của InterServer
Lưu trữ chia sẻ với mức phí $2,50 USD mỗi tháng, giảm giá $0,1 USD trong tháng đầu tiên, mã giảm giá tryinterserver, với 461 ứng dụng đám mây và cài đặt chỉ bằng một cú nhấp chuột.

Yếu tố nào quan trọng nhất trong quá trình tối ưu hóa?

Thật khó để cô lập và nhấn mạnh một yếu tố nào đó là “quan trọng nhất”, bởi vì tối ưu hóa là một chuỗi liên kết. Tuy nhiên, nếu buộc phải chọn một điểm khởi đầu, thì đó nên là “triển khai bộ nhớ đệm” trong “tối ưu hóa tốc độ”. Một cơ chế bộ nhớ đệm hiệu quả có thể ngay lập tức giải quyết điểm nghẽn hiệu suất lớn nhất — quá nhiều truy vấn cơ sở dữ liệu và tạo trang động, mang lại lợi ích tức thì cho trải nghiệm người dùng và SEO (tốc độ tải trang là một yếu tố xếp hạng). Trên cơ sở này, việc tăng cường bảo mật và đào sâu SEO một cách có hệ thống sẽ tạo thành một tam giác tối ưu vững chắc.